50 measuring transducer (with electrical output)
измерительный преобразователь (с электрическим выходом)
-
[IEV number 312-02-15]EN
measuring transducer (with electrical output)
device intended to transform, with a specified accuracy and according to a given law, the measurand, or a quantity already transformed therefrom, into an electrical quantity
NOTE 1 – If the input quantity is electrical, the input and output quantities may not be of the same kind, for example, a voltage and a current.
NOTE 2 – In certain instances, measuring transducers also have a specific name in respect of their function, (for example, amplifier, converter, transformer, frequency transducer, etc.).
Source: ≈ VIM 4.3

52 fundamental frequency
основная частота
первая гармоника
Низшая собственная частота колебательной системы.
Единица измерения
Гц
[Система неразрушающего контроля. Виды (методы) и технология неразрушающего контроля. Термины и определения (справочное пособие). Москва 2003 г.]
основная частота
Частота в спектре, полученном путем преобразования Фурье функции времени, относительно которой рассматриваются все частоты спектра.
В случае возможного риска неопределенности при определении основной частоты данная частота должна быть определена с учетом числа полюсов и скорости вращения синхронного генератора (генераторов), питающего систему электроснабжения.
[ ГОСТ Р 51317.4.30-2008 (МЭК 61000-4-30:2008)]EN
fundamental frequency
frequency in the spectrum obtained from a Fourier transform of a time function, to which all the frequencies of the spectrum are referred
NOTE In case of any remaining risk of ambiguity, the fundamental frequency may be derived from the number of poles and speed of rotation of the synchronous generator(s) feeding the system
